A simple installation might cost about $2,000, but it can be more than that depending upon your specific situation. ![]() The placement of the generator, the amount of materials required, and the installation of the natural gas or LP fuel source all make estimating installation costs unique. Gas pipe size will depend on length of run from the source and how many elbows and T’s there are.Įvery home is different, and so is every installation. We recommending contacting your gas provider, or a licensed plumber, and they will be able to size the gas line for you. No circuit is ever left uncovered, so every appliance is available every minute.Įxplore our automatic home backup solutions They are cycled back on when essential circuits no longer require power, so all circuits receive power at different times.Ĭomplete Whole House Coverage – Easily cover every circuit in your home by pairing one of Generac’s larger kW units and the proper transfer switch to provide full coverage. This creates a managed power solution where non-essential circuits are shed when the generator approaches maximum capacity. Managed Whole House Coverage – You can get more coverage with less generator, up to whole house coverage, by pairing a smaller generator with one of Generac’s load shedding options. Each circuit is directly connected to a matched circuit on the home’s main circuit breaker panel, providing electricity to that specific appliance or area of the home. The generator is paired with a transfer switch containing a predetermined number of circuits based on the generator’s kW power rating. Other systems are available to cover virtually any application:Įssential Circuit Coverage – Generac takes the guesswork out of sizing by offering prepackaged Guardian Series generator systems. With the broadest product line available, essential circuit coverage starts with the economically priced Generac PowerPact™ Series.
